Today’s program and Speakers:

Assemblyman Joe Robach was our guest speaker this afternoon.  He talked about the state of New York especially since Sept 11th.

 

He stated the state will be affected financially

for about 15 months by Sept 11th.

 

The WTC produced about 47 billion of NYS economy.  5 billion came to the state in sales tax receipts alone.

The WTC was worst than Pearl Harbor because of the huge economic impact and that it was an attack on regular citizen instead of the armed forces.

 

One good affect of the WTC attack has been that Albany has been less partisan.  Maybe the budget will be passed on time!!!
